Here's a tip - point those exhaust pipes BACK as much as you can - especially if you start spooling your turbo before you stage. I redlighted my first elimination round because the smoke rolled in and staged me before my tires were in the beams, so I stopped. Then the smoke cleared before my tree started and my tires weren't there, so the red light came on. Boy did that hurt!
Then, a few trucks behind me, my friend in his Ford had a different smoke problem. The smoke obscured the beams when he left the line for about a second and a half, so he broke out, even though he beat the other truck. He was on the brakes HARD and went through the traps at only 55 mph, but still broke out. The wind was not in our favor...
